Federal Reserve Governor Christopher Waller said on Thursday he continues to believe the U.S. central bank should cut interest rates at the end of this month amid mounting risks to the economy and the strong likelihood that tariff-induced inflation will not drive a persistent rise in price pressures. "It makes sense to cut the FOMC's policy rate by 25 basis points two weeks from now," Waller told a gathering of the Money Marketeers of New York University. US Stocks Close Higher
Saturday, 1 March 2025 03:55 WIB |

US stocks closed higher on Friday, with the S&P 500 and Nasdaq each up 1.6%, while the Dow gained 601 points. Investors weighed a tense exchange between President Donald Trump and Ukraine's Volodymyr Zelenskyy in the Oval Office. Vance called Zelensky "disrespectful," while Trump accused Zelensky of "gambling with World War III." Trump's tariff threats also rekindled warnings of retaliation from China, raising uncertainty, especially in Big Tech. European Stocks Down Slightly
Saturday, 1 March 2025 01:22 WIB | SahamEropa

European stocks pared early morning gains but still closed slightly lower on Friday, ending a volatile week as markets continued to assess the impact of U.S. tariffs on the EU on the European economy. The Eurozone STOXX 50 fell 0.4% to close at 5,451, not too far from a record high hit last week, while the STOXX 600 closed just below the flatline at 557, just below Wednesday's all-time high. Technology stocks led the declines as markets weighed the cautious outlook for the U.S. tech sector and potential tariffs from Washington, with ASML and Infineon down 3-1% and 2.2% respectively. US Stocks Waver, Nasdaq to Book Worst Month Since 2023
Friday, 28 February 2025 22:07 WIB |

The S&P 500 hovered around the flatline, the Nasdaq fell about 0.6% and the Dow Jones gained nearly 90 points on Friday, with the tech sector remaining under pressure and traders digesting the latest PCE report and escalating trade tensions. Nvidia shares dropped 2%, extending the previous session's sell-off after its quarterly results failed to impress investors. Also, Broadcom was down 0.8%, Tesla fell 0.9%, and Oracle slipped 2%. European markets open lower as U.S. tariff threat weighs on sentiment
Friday, 28 February 2025 17:02 WIB | Eropa

European markets opened in negative territory on Friday, after U.S. President Donald Trump threatened once again to slap tariffs on the EU and followed through with new levies on Canada and Mexico.  The pan-European Stoxx 600 index was 0.5% lower during early trade, with almost every sector losing ground. All major bourses saw losses, with France's CAC 40 and the German Dax both down more than 0.5%. Hang Seng Down More Than 3% at Close, But Up 13% Monthly
Friday, 28 February 2025 15:24 WIB | HANG SENG IndeksHangSeng

The Hang Seng plunged 777 points, or 3.3%, to close at 22,941 on Friday, falling for a second day after the U.S. slapped 10% tariffs on Chinese imports, adding to the 10% tariffs imposed on Feb. 4 to bring the total to 20%. In response, China vowed to take all "necessary" countermeasures, further escalating tensions between the two countries. The market extended its decline from a three-year high, down 2.3% weekly, as losses hit all sectors.
